在Pandas Python中,Group by with where查询是一种基于条件筛选和分组的数据处理操作。它允许我们根据特定的条件对数据进行分组,并对每个分组应用相应的聚合函数或其他操作。
具体而言,Group by with where查询可以通过以下步骤实现:
import pandas as pd
# 导入数据集
data = pd.read_csv('data.csv')
# 使用where条件筛选数据
filtered_data = data.where(data['column_name'] > 10)
# 使用Group by对筛选后的数据进行分组
grouped_data = filtered_data.groupby('group_column')
# 对每个分组应用聚合函数或其他操作
result = grouped_data['column_name'].sum()
在上述代码中,'column_name'表示要筛选和分组的列名,'group_column'表示用于分组的列名。可以根据实际需求进行调整。
Group by with where查询的优势包括:
Group by with where查询在许多场景下都有广泛的应用,例如:
腾讯云提供了一系列与云计算相关的产品,其中包括适用于数据处理和分析的云原生数据库TDSQL、云数据库CDB,以及适用于大数据处理的云数据仓库CDW等。您可以通过以下链接了解更多关于腾讯云产品的信息:
请注意,以上链接仅供参考,具体的产品选择应根据实际需求和情况进行评估和决策。
领取专属 10元无门槛券
手把手带您无忧上云